Transaction e8f15c155011e6619d2273a363d2314a32c0a237cf53676489b9e4f7992ab821

1 Input
2 Outputs
  • e8f15c155011e6619d2273a363d2314a32c0a237cf53676489b9e4f7992ab821:0
  • value  510000
    address  17UWEng686TGuBqwQJmAYuN8oDj8S136az
  • e8f15c155011e6619d2273a363d2314a32c0a237cf53676489b9e4f7992ab821:1
  • value  155023385
    address  16UHuDYbDzsGdUdBaKUcctakG4iNV7XCL8